King Narai's Palace
King Narai's Palace is a remarkable feature of the geography and culture of Thailand. A palace complex in Lopburi, built by King Narai the Great in the 17th century, showcasing a blend of Thai and European architecture. Served as a second capital of the Ayutthaya Kingdom. French architects were involved in its construction. Today it houses a national museum. Best time to visit & climate
The most pleasant time to visit is Jan, Nov, Dec.
| Jan | Feb | Mar | Apr | May | Jun | Jul | Aug | Sep | Oct | Nov | Dec |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Avg °C | 26 | 29 | 31 | 31 | 30 | 28 | 28 | 27 | 27 | 26 | 25 | 25 |
| Rain mm | 11 | 11 | 41 | 71 | 141 | 144 | 148 | 171 | 260 | 162 | 28 | 8 |
